DRUG INEFFECTIVE is the #4 most commonly reported adverse reaction for METHYLPHENIDATE, manufactured by Noven Therapeutics, LLC. There are 2,873 FDA adverse event reports linking METHYLPHENIDATE to DRUG INEFFECTIVE. This represents approximately 4.5% of all 63,290 adverse event reports for this drug.
